So, NaNoWriMo, huh? National Novel Writing Month. There are two parts to it: the writing challenge, and the organization. The writing challenge portion of it started back in 1999 when writer Chris Baty and his friends in the San Francisco Bay area decided to tackle the idea of writing 50,000 words in a month.
